Middleton commissioners weigh FAQ wording as industry debates unleaded aviation fuel

Middleton Airport Commission · January 10,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

Commissioners recommended clarifying the airport FAQ to reflect manufacturer concerns, technical limits (single 10,000-gallon tank), the FAA's slow timeline, and to add disclaimers/links; staff will draft redlines and keep the item on future agendas.

The Middleton Airport Commission discussed updates to the airport website’s FAQ about unleaded aviation fuels amid changing manufacturer guidance and industry uncertainty.
